private void AddOrUpdateParameter(IParameterManager paramMgr, IParameter param) { if (!paramMgr.Contains(param)) { paramMgr.Add(param); } else { paramMgr.Update(param); } }
public void ParameterManager_Update_UpdatesParameter() { mParamMgr.Add(new SerializableParameter(mKey1, mParam)); mParamMgr.Update(new SerializableParameter(mKey1, "stuff")); Assert.AreSame(mParamMgr.Get(mKey1).ParameterValue, "stuff"); }